WebDental implants have been known to fail in people taking oral bisphosphonates. However, studies of patients taking oral bisphosphonates and receiving dental implants indicate a very low risk of either implant loss or BRONJ following implant placement, especially if the person has been taking the bisphosphonate for less than three years. WebDec 6, 2024 · Bisphosphonates are usually the first choice for osteoporosis treatment. These include: Alendronate (Fosamax), a weekly pill. Risedronate (Actonel), a weekly or monthly pill. Ibandronate (Boniva), a monthly pill or quarterly intravenous (IV) infusion. Zoledronic acid (Reclast), an annual IV infusion.
